There’s yet another superhero movie coming out soon called The Green Lantern (as if anyone’s ever heard of that, but Superman and Spiderman are way done, and there are only so many excuses producers can use to make a movie with a hunk in a spandex suit.)

But the movie itself isn’t the center of the gossip – it’s who will play the main character, hot-shot pilot Hal Jordan?  So far, according to Laineygossip.com, the major contenders are as follows:  Ryan Reynolds, Bradley Cooper, Justin Timberlake, and Henry Cavill.

Ryan Reynolds apparently doesn’t belong on this list because he’s scheduled to star in Deadpool, but maybe he’d back out for a bigger offer?  There’s no doubt he looks the part (all of these guys do) but his dramatic acting skills have yet to be truly tested.

Bradley Cooper – well, he’s really good at playing an arrogant douche bag, so I guess that fits.

Justin Timberlake – Has anyone seen Austin Powers?  Is it not obvious to everyone that this kid cannot act??  Sure, he can pull off an SNL skit, but that doesn’t mean you throw him up on the big screen for a summer blockbuster!

Henry Cavill – if you guys don’t know who this is, he’s the tall, dark and British hunk on the TV show The Tudors.  He was also the first choice of Stephenie Meyer to play her brooding vamp, Edward Cullen, but was passed over because he was too old.

Which brings me to my next point:  Don’t these guys all seem just a tad….OLD???  I mean, all of these guys are hovering by their thirties, and if I am asking for a hero, he’s gotta be at least 25 or younger.  Anyone heard of Shia LeBeouf?  Emile Hirsch?  Hayden Christensen?
